Please be advised of the following planned outages scheduled for Wednesday, June 24, 2026:
▪Dundee Bay Villas & Princess Isles
9:00 AM – 4:00 PM
To facilitate essential upgrades to the electrical infrastructure serving these areas.
▪Bootle Bay
9:30 AM – 1:30 PM
To facilitate vegetation management activities around electrical infrastructure.
These planned outages are necessary to support ongoing improvements aimed at enhancing the reliability, safety, and efficiency of our electrical system.

A vacancy exists at the Grand Bahama Development Company for a Human Resources Manager.
The Human Resources Manager is responsible for leading and managing all human resource functions,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ives. This role oversees recruitment, employee and labour relations, performance management, compensation and benefits, training and development, policy implementation, and compliance. You will serve as a strategic partner to management while fostering a positive and productive workplace culture.

🥊 All Out Summer Camp is here!
The Ministry of Youth, Sports and Culture, in partnership with All Out Boxing Club, presents the All Out Summer Camp from July 10–20, 12:00 PM–3:00 PM at CrossFit Gym.
Open to ages 10–17 and all skill levels. Camp includes boxing fundamentals, strength & conditioning, sparring sessions, and nutrition guidance.
